@charset "utf-8";
/* CSS Document */
           
#dd {
	width: 880px;
	margin: 0 auto;
}
#dd .mainmenu {
	margin: 0;
	padding: 0;
	list-style: none;
	float: left;
	background: #ffffff;
}
#dd li {
	list-style-type: none;
}

#mmenu1 {
	width: 82px;
}
#mmenu2 {
	width: 114px;
}
#dd .mainmenu a.menu {
  display: block;
  text-align: left;
  padding:0;
  margin:0;
  text-decoration: none;
}
#dd .mainmenu a.menu:hover {
}
	
.submenu {
	background: #E0E9E9;
	border: 1px solid #3C8ACA;
	border-top: none;
	visibility: hidden;
	position: absolute;
	z-index: 3;
	width: 160px;
}
#menu8 {
	width: 190px;
	margin-left: -80px;
}

.submenu a {
	font-size: 12px;
	line-height: 1em;
	display: block;
	text-decoration: none;
	color: #507A83;
	padding: 6px 5px 6px;
	/*border-bottom: 1px dotted #aaa;*/
	_height: 13px;
}
*:first-child+html .submenu a {
	height: 13px;
}
.submenu a.navi_cate_top {
	border-bottom: 1px solid #ACBFC4;
}
.submenu a:link {
	text-decoration: none;
	color: #507A83;
}
.submenu a:visited {
	color: #507A83;
}
.submenu a:hover {
	text-decoration: none;
	color: #ffffff;
	background: #F90;
}
.submenu a:active {
	color: #fff;
}


.add_line {
	border-top: 1px solid #ACBFC4;
}
/*.submenu a.ssmenu {
	border-bottom: none;
}*/

li a.ssmenu  {
	font-size: 12px;
	padding-left: 20px;
}


/* サブメニューの半透明処理
--------------------*/
/*.submenu {
 filter: alpha(Opacity=90);
	opacity: 0.9;
	opacity: 1;
}*/





